Google to Notify Webmasters when Switching to Mobile First Indexing

During a presentation given by Senior Webmaster Trends Analyst John Mueller at SMX Munich, he announced that one of Google’s next planned steps will be to “send ‘fyi’ messages in Search Console when switching”.

Google’s history with announcing updates and changes to their algorithm has often been spotty. Usually, when there is a change made that impacts the rankings of websites, Google’s response is something to the effect of “Google usually releases one or more changes designed to improve our results. Some are focused around specific improvements. Some are broad changes (source)”.

It is interesting that Google has decided to let webmasters know when their site has been moved over to mobile first indexing. This will allow webmasters a good idea of when the change occurs, what the effects are in terms of organic performance, and issues that should be addressed.
